Norm D
Reviewed a 1963 Pontiac Grand Prix on Jul 27, 2010
The owner before me had broken both motor mounts. There was a chain (!!) bolted to each upper control arm, over the top of the engine, with wood boards jammed under the chain where it crossed the valve covers (to protect them?? I don't know). It worked pretty good at keeping the engine in place, except the oil-soaked wood caught fire after I drove it kinda hard for a hour or so... hahaha.
